The President of the Transition, Head of State, Captain Ibrahim Traoré, visited on Wednesday the stands of the International Synergy Exhibition for Safety, Security, and Defense (SYSDEF), which opened its doors on Tuesday, July 4th, in the capital of Burkina Faso.

According to the SYSDEF Commissioner, Hyacinthe Zoure, the President’s visit shows that he is close to his people.

Under the theme «What Contributions Can the Private Sector Make to State Security? », this first edition brings together all military and paramilitary forces, as well as private sector actors who offer security and defense tools and services.

«We also highlighted the youth who are innovating through the organization of a hackathon focused on security and defense solutions because we really want to support the security and defense industry», supported the SYSDEF Commissioner.

The launch of SYSDEF’s activities on July 4th was conducted by the Chief of Staff of the President of the Transition, Captain Martha Céleste Anderson MEDAH. Around fifteen African, European, and Asian companies are participating in the exhibition.
